Re: Merrily Playing Cards by Joustice
This actually a very nicely designed deck, IMHO. Custom pips, nice thematic courts. The face cards captures the theme very well. Back looks lacking compared to the faces. Doesn't grab me. Tuck is average. But I like the fun Christmas feel and his design style.
It's a pity it won't fund. Too ambitious at $18+k funding goal in this current state. I don't mind MPC as Christmas decks are more for design theme than anything else. But 2 decks? Nice that the green deck is an option rather than a set. But the green should have been a stretch goal to lower the funding goal.
The biggest killer is the shipping cost. $24 total for 1 basic deck and $29 for the green deck shipped to the US and only for selected countries. Why, when MPC is shipping it out from HK?
I like this deck, but I really do hope he works out something better in terms of his costs or he's not going to get any decks funded.
